Raspberry pi Os

Introduction

 

Le système d’exploitation Raspberry pi OS, anciennement Raspbian est le système d’exploitation le plus connue et utilisé sur Raspberry pi.

C’est celui que nous vous conseillons d’utiliser si vous débutez sur Raspberry pi car vous trouverez facilement des tutoriels dessus (comme le nôtre) et de l’aide sur les forums. De plus de nombreux logiciels sont développés sur ce système, contrairement aux autres systèmes d’exploitation sur Raspberry pi qui sont moins mis à jour.

Raspberry pi OS existe depuis le début de la carte Raspberry pi.

Astuce

Raspberry pi OS s’appelait jusqu’à pas longtemps Raspbian. Si vous cherchez des informations dessus n’hésitez pas à tapez raspbian, comme ça vous pourrez profiter de toute les aides qui sont encore valable sur Raspberry pi OS.

Dans ce cours vous verrez comment télécharger et installer Raspberry pi OS sur votre Raspberry pi. On va aussi présenter les différents logiciels présents sur le système d’exploitation et leurs utilités. Enfin on verra comment utiliser votre Raspberry pi à distance.

 

 

Téléchargement

 

Même si c’est le système d’exploitation le plus utilisé sur Raspberry pi, celle-ci n’est pas livré avec Raspberry pi os déjà installé. On va donc voir comment le télécharger puis l’installer sur votre carte.

Il y a plusieurs versions de raspberry pi os :

 

 

 

 

 

 

 

 

La première version correspond au système d’exploitation Raspberry pi os avec pré installé et une suite de logiciel en plus de la deuxième proposition : Libre office et d’autre logiciel utile quand vous voulez utiliser votre Raspberry pi comme un ordinateur normal.

La deuxième proposition corresponds au système d’exploitation Raspberry pi os sans les logiciels cité précédemment, ce qui peut vous laisser plus de place si vous souhaitez faire des projets dessus et qu’utilisez un Raspberry pi comme un ordinateur standard vous intéresse moins.

Enfin vous pouvez installer Raspberry pi OS Lite si vous avez une mauvaise connexion internet sur votre ordinateur ou bien si vous êtes impatient de commencer l’installation. En effet, le fichier que vous allez télécharger ne contient pas Raspberry pi OS mais un installateur qui muni d’internet va vous l’installez. Il vous faudra donc une bonne connexion internet sur votre Raspberry pi afin de pouvoir l’utiliser.

Pour ce cours, nous téléchargerons la première version : Raspberry pi OS and recommended software.

Pour pouvoir installer la version que vous avez choisi, vous devez télécharger l’installateur sur le site de Raspberry pi :  https://www.raspberrypi.org/software/

Voici ce que vous allez obtenir :

 

 

 

 

 

 

 

 

Cliquez sur choose your os :

 

 

 

 

 

 

 

 

 

Comme on a dit précédemment, nous allons installer Raspberry pi OS (32-bit). Choisissez votre carte sd et l’os qui vous intéresse puis faite write.

Une fois le téléchargement terminé vous pouvez passer à l’installation en mettant votre carte micro sd dans votre raspberry pi.

 

Installation

 

Pour l’installer, il n’y a rien de plus facile. Une fois la raspberry pi démarré, elle va toute seule ouvrir le bureau. Il vous restera juste à configurer le pays, la langue afin de finir l’installation :

 

On va ensuite vous demander de changer un mot de passe qui est pour l’instant « pi » par défaut. Vous pouvez cliquer sur next sans rien écrire si vous voulez garder le mot de passe par défaut.

On vous propose ensuite de faire la mise à jour de votre système afin de commencer votre expérience sur Raspberry pi OS avec les versions de logiciels les plus récentes.

 

On nous propose ensuite de redémarrer le Raspberry pi OS, puis vous pourrez profiter de votre nouvelle installation.

Découverte de Raspberry pi Os

 

Une fois l’installation terminé, vous vous retrouvez sur le bureau. On peut voir que contrairement à beaucoup de système d’exploitation, la barre de menu est située en haut de l’écran.

Voici ce que l’on peut retrouver dans cette barre :

 

a. Programming

On peut voir que Raspberry pi OS est livré avec plusieurs logiciel permettant de faire de la programmation :

On va vous faire une rapide description des différents logiciels afin que vous y voyiez plus clair :

 

 

Blue Java IDE : Ce logiciel est un environnement de programmation pour java, ou vous dessinez le schéma UML de votre programme sous forme de classe et le logiciel vous le compile en java pour vous donner le programme à partir de votre schéma.

 

 

 

 

 

Scratch : Scratch est un langage de programmation destiné aux plus jeunes qui permet de comprendre la programmation. Les lignes de code sont remplacées par des instructions à déplacer dans un ordre précis afin de faire bouger le petit chat.

 

 

 

 

 

Thony : Thony est un logiciel de programmation pour le langage python. Celui-ci est assez connus pour Windows et a été implanté sur Raspberry pi. Vous avez votre fichier untitled où vous pouvez écrire du texte et une console en dessous (Shell) pour lancer votre programme.

 

 

 

 

b. Education

 

Smartsim est un logiciel de simulation électronique qui va vous permettre de dessiner tous vos schémas électroniques et de les tester sur les logiciels avant de les réaliser en vrai sur votre Raspberry pi ou Arduino. Vous avez ensuite plusieurs fonctions qui vous permet de tester la validité de votre de circuit avant de le faire en vrai.

 

 

 

c. La suite office

 

 

Ici vous avez la toute la suite office qui vous permet d’écrire du texte, d’avoir une feuille de calcul sur Excel, d’avoir des slides comme sur PowerPoint avec LibreOffice Impress.

 

 

d.Internet

Raspberry Pi OS met à disposition un navigateur internet venant de google chrome. Avec ce navigateur dédié à Raspberry Pi vous pouvez faire exactement la même chose qu’avec un vrai navigateur sur votre ordinateur. Claws Mail est logiciel de mail qui va vous permettre de recevoir et d’envoyer tous vos mails comme avec Outlook.

 

e.Lecteur Vidéo

Raspberry pi OS contient aussi un lecteur de music ou de vidéo qui permet de regarder n’importe quelle vidéo.

f. Visionneur d’image

Raspberry pi contient aussi un visionner d’image qui va vous permettre de visionner toute vos photos.

g.Jeux vidéo

 

Enfin Raspberry pi contient des jeux déjà intégrer, certain dédié à Raspberry pi et d’autre sont des jeux python qui sont installé sur Raspberry pi car celui-ci comprend le langage python :

Voici un exemple de jeu que vous pouvez retrouver sur votre Raspberry pi OS : Le puissance 4 :

 

 

Mise à jour de votre Système

 

Il est possible qu’après avoir utilisé votre raspberry pi pendant un moment, celui-ci ne soit plus à jour. Si vous voulez mettre à jour votre système ou bien vos logiciels installés, voici la procédure :

Ouvrez le terminal depuis l’icône sur votre bureau :

Puis tapez la ligne suivante pour mettre à jour Raspberry pi OS :

sudo apt-get udapte

 

Vous pouvez ensuite mettre à jour les paquets de votre rapsberry pi OS :

sudo apt-get dist-upgrade

 

Vous aurez maintenant un Raspberry pi OS mise à jour.

Le SSH sur Raspberry Pi

 

On va maintenant voir comment utiliser le ssh sur Raspberry pi.

Qu’est-ce que le SSH ?

 

Le ssh est une connexion sécurisée à distance (secure shell) qui va vous permettre d’accéder à votre raspberry pi depuis un autre ordinateur. Vous aurez néanmoins accès qu’au terminal de celui-ci et pas à votre bureau graphique. Pour avoir accès au bureau graphique, il faut utiliser le vnc, que l’on va voir juste après.

a.Activation SSH

Tout d’abord il faut autorisée l’accès à la connexion SSH qui est par défaut désactiver sur Raspberry pi OS. Pour cela vous devez allez dans préférence puis Raspberry pi configuration et Interfaces.

b.Installation de PuTTY

Ensuite il vous faut installer sur votre ordinateur Windows le logiciel PuTTY qui va vous permettre de vous connecter à votre Raspberry pi.

Voici le logiciel à télécharger : https://www.chiark.greenend.org.uk/~sgtatham/putty/latest.html

Voici ce que l’on obtient une fois téléchargée :

Comme vous pouvez voir, il nous faut l’adresse IP du Raspberry Pi afin de pouvoir s’y connecter. On va voir comment la trouver.

c.Adresse Ip Raspberry Pi OS

Afin de trouver l’adresse IP du Raspberry Pi, il va falloir revenir sur celui-ci. Pour cela en cliquant sur le logo de l’internet sur la droite on obtient notre adresse IP, qui est ici 192.168.0.101 sur le port 24.

d.Connexion sur PuTTY

On va maintenant taper cette adresse IP dans PuTTY pour pouvoir se connecter.

Pour le port vous pouvez laisser 22 qui est celui de base et qui fonctionne pour Raspberry pi.

Une fois cliqué sur open, voici ce que vous devriez obtenir :

Ici on vous demande le nom du compte de votre Raspberry pi et son mot de mot passe. Si vous n’avez pas configurer de mot de passe, par défaut le nom du compte est pi et le mot de passe est pi aussi.

Une fois validé voici ce que vous devriez obtenir :

Ici vous pouvez directement communiquer avec votre Raspberry pi. Il recevra vos commandes exactement comme si vous étiez devant sur le terminal de commande.

Le VNC sur Raspberry Pi

 

On va maintenant voire comment utiliser le vnc sur Raspberry Pi.

Qu’est-ce que le VNC ?

 

VNC ou Virtual Network computing, est un système qui va vous permettre de prendre le contrôle de votre Raspberry pi à distance depuis votre ordinateur. La différence entre le ssh et le vnc c’est que le vnc vous permet d’avoir accès au bureau graphique de votre Raspberry pi alors que le ssh lui ne vous donnait accès qu’a l’interface de commande.

a.Activer le VNC

On va maintenant voire comment activer le VNC sur Raspberry pi.

b.Installation de real VNC

On va maintenant installer Real VNC. Il y a deux logiciels VNC : VNC Server et VNC Viewer. VNC Server permet de visionner des machines et d’être la machine hote alors que vnc viewer permet juste de visionner la machine hote. Dans notre cas, le Rasberry pi est la machine hote donc on a juste besoin de VNC Viewer.

Vous pouvez trouver VNC Viewer ici :  https://www.realvnc.com/fr/connect/download/viewer/

Une fois installé voici ce que l’on obtient :

On va maintenant chercher l’adresse IP du Raspberry pi :

Une fois l’adresse tapée dans VNC Viewer, voici ce que l’on obtient :

 

On nous demande de s’identifier pour se connecter au Raspberry pi. Si vous n’avez pas configurer votre Raspberry pi, le nom de compte est par défaut pi et le mot de passe est pi.

Une fois accepté, on arrive sur le bureau du Raspberry pi, et vous pouvez profiter de Raspberry pi OS :